Abstract

The present invention is a method to quantify biomarkers. The method uses an X-ray fluorescence spectrometer to perform an X-ray fluorescence analysis on the sample to obtain spectral features derived from the biomarker; and quantifying the X-ray fluorescence signal of the biomarker.

Claims (18)

1. A method for measuring a response to a therapy, comprising

providing a sample which has been exposed to a therapy and a sample which has not been exposed to a therapy, the samples each comprising a biomarker comprising one or more chemicals that are related to a physiological condition;

preparing the samples for X-ray analysis by exposing the samples to a solution;

using an X-ray fluorescence spectrometer to perform an X-ray fluorescence analysis on the samples to obtain spectral features derived from the biomarker; and

quantifying the X-ray fluorescence signal of the biomarker and comparing the signal of the sample which has been exposed to a therapy and a sample which has not been exposed to a therapy;

wherein the X-ray fluorescence spectrometer irradiates the sample with polychromatic X-rays.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the solution is selected from a pH buffer, a redox buffer, a preservative, a fixative, and a sterilizing solution.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the solution is free of at least one chemical element having an atomic number greater than eight, where the element is present in the sample.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the solution is free of at least one of the chemicals or functional groups selected from the group consisting of dimethylsulfoxide, thiols, sulfate anion, sulfonate anions, chloride anion, bromide anion, fluoride anion, iodide anion, perchlorate anion, phosphate anion, and phosphonate anions.

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the solution comprises one or more chemicals selected from the group consisting of amine, imine, nitrate anion, nitrite anion, ammonium cation, acetate anion, carboxylate anion, conjugate bases of carboxylic acids, carbonate anion, formalin, formaldehyde, ethanol, 2-propanol, and iminium cation.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the samples are fractionated to provide sample fractions.

7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the fractionating is performed using a technique selected from centrifugation, mechanical separation, chemical separation, enzymatic separation, condensation, chromatographic methods, gel electrophoresis, isoelectric focusing, 2-dimensional electrophoresis, precipitation, density gradient fractionation and immobilization of analytes to solid formats.

8. The method of claim 7 , wherein the solid format is selected from beads, membranes, arrays, microarrays, spin plate, or well plates.

9. The method of claim 1 , wherein at least one sample is disposed on or in a sample holder, and the sample holder comprises at least one chemical element which is not present in the sample.

10. The method of claim 1 , wherein the samples are biological samples.

11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the biological samples are selected from tissue samples, biological fluids, biopsy samples, cells, dried biospecimens, fresh biospecimens, immortalized cell lines, membranes, plasma, primary cell cultures, and subcellular fractionates.

12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the fluorescence analysis comprises multiple X-ray fluorescence analyses.

13. The method of claim 12 , wherein the multiple fluorescence analyses are obtained by disposing one or more of the samples at two or more different angles relative to an excitation source.
